This Futaba FU6A15501 extension cord is an RC accessory designed to extend the connection between an in-line noise filter and your model electronics. The cable uses a 50-strand heavy-duty conductor arrangement and offers a 220mm overall length, giving flexible routing options in compact radio-controlled model layouts.
Purpose: the lead lets you place the filter away from crowded component bays to preserve signal integrity and tidy wiring between receiver, servos, and electronic speed controllers. This helps reduce interference risk while keeping harnesses neat without suggesting any use beyond RC models.
Installation notes: route the cable to avoid sharp bends and high-heat sources, secure it with tape or cable ties at anchor points, and keep power and signal runs separated where possible. Confirm connector fit with your existing filter and device wiring before final installation, and inspect crimps or terminations for secure contact after any adjustments.
Troubleshooting tips: if noise remains after fitting the extension and filter, check ground continuity and the quality of each connection, try alternate cable routing to increase separation from high-current leads, and verify the filter placement relative to the receiver and primary noise sources.
